KARACHI: The Art & Craft Exhibition organized by the Department of Architecture and Civil Technology at Aligarh Institute of Technology (AIT), Karachi, captured significant attention from academic and creative circles alike. This vibrant and inspiring event featured participation from approximately 70 students, who demonstrated their talent through paintings, architectural models, and innovative craftwork.


More than 50 creative pieces were displayed, reflecting a beautiful fusion of art and technology. Guests and attendees highly appreciated the students’ efforts and artistic expression. The exhibition was divided into four categories, with model-making and creative design standing out prominently in the craft section. The event was inaugurated by the Principal of AIT, Shahid Jamil.
The judging panel was led by renowned fine artist and design studio instructor Sania Arif, an internationally acclaimed artist who has represented Pakistan in 22 countries. She has received numerous awards, and her artwork has been featured at the Winter Olympics as well as in China’s National Museum. She has been actively contributing to the field of art for the past 19 years.
The chief guest of the event was Chairman of the Governing Body and Chancellor of Sir Syed University Muhammad Akbar Ali Khan,  Also present were Convener Syed Muhammad Mohsin Kazim and Principal AIT Shahid Jamil. At the conclusion of the event, outstanding students were awarded prizes and cash rewards, encouraging and recognizing their efforts.
In his address, Muhammad Akbar Ali Khan expressed deep admiration for the students’ creativity, stating that their achievements reflect their hard work and the strong support of their parents, which will pave the way for a bright future. He emphasized that such activities provide students with opportunities to establish their identity at both national and international levels.
Principal Shahid Jameel described the exhibition as a clear reflection of the institution’s academic excellence and the creative mindset of its students. Convener AIT Syed Muhammad Mohsin Kazim highlighted the significant increase in admissions to the Architecture program this year, attributing it partly to such engaging activities. Although not part of the formal curriculum, these initiatives play a vital role in the creative, intellectual, and practical development of students.
Head of the Department of Architecture and Civil Technology, Miss Madiha Younis, stated that the institute is committed to providing world-class education along with practical skills, enabling students to excel on an international platform.
Students also regarded the exhibition as an excellent opportunity to showcase their abilities and boost their confidence.
At the end of the event, the Architecture Department’s social media team was awarded a special shield in recognition of their outstanding performance, adding a memorable touch to the occasion
